Tiger Boys Basketball Camps Start in May

Registration is available for boys in grades 2-8.

Lawrenceburg won their first sectional title since 2009 in March. Photo via @LburgTigerHoops.

(Lawrenceburg, Ind.) – Registration is open for Tiger Boys Basketball Camps.

Boys in grades 2-8 are invited to attend the four-day camps that will be split by grade.

Cost is $45 and campers will receive a t-shirt and instruction from high school coaches. Campers in grades 7 and 8 will also have an opportunity to attend additional practices and an overnight team camp at Hanover College on June 23-24.

Camp dates, times, and locations for various grades are listed below:

  • Grade 2 / 4:00-5:15 PM / May 2-5 / at LPS
  • Grade 3 / 4:00-5:15 PM / May 9-12 / at LPS
  • Grade 4 / 4:00-5:15 PM / May 16-19 / at CES; May 19 from 5:30-6:45 PM at CES
  • Grades 5-6 / 9:00-10:30 AM / May 31-June 3 / at GMS
  • Grades 7-8 / 10:30-Noon / May 31-June 3 / at GMS
